legongju.com
我们一直在努力
2025-01-10 22:42 | 星期五

如何理解Oracle的sign函数作用

Oracle的SIGN函数是一个数学函数,用于返回一个数值表达式的符号

以下是SIGN函数的基本语法:

SIGN(expression)

其中,expression是要计算符号的数值表达式。

expression的值为正数时,SIGN函数返回1;当expression的值为负数时,SIGN函数返回-1;当expression的值为0时,SIGN函数返回0。

SIGN函数可以用于比较两个数值,判断它们的大小关系,或者根据某个数值的符号来执行不同的操作。例如,你可以使用SIGN函数来计算两个数值之间的差值,并根据差值的符号来确定哪个数值更大。

以下是一个简单的示例,展示了如何使用SIGN函数:

SELECT SIGN(10 - 5) AS result FROM DUAL;

在这个示例中,我们计算了10和5之间的差值(10 - 5 = 5),然后使用SIGN函数获取差值的符号。因为差值为正数,所以SIGN函数返回1。

未经允许不得转载 » 本文链接:https://www.legongju.com/article/99763.html

相关推荐

  • Oracle的sign函数支持哪些数据类型

    Oracle的sign函数支持哪些数据类型

    Oracle的SIGN函数接受以下数据类型作为输入: NUMBER:这是最常用的数据类型,可以表示整数和小数。
    INTEGER:整数类型,只能表示整数。
    FLOAT:浮点数...

  • sign函数在Oracle查询中的效率如何

    sign函数在Oracle查询中的效率如何

    SIGN 函数在 Oracle 数据库中通常用于返回一个数字的符号(正数、负数或零)。其效率取决于多个因素,包括: 使用场景:如果你只是偶尔需要计算一个数字的符号,...

  • 如何优化使用Oracle的sign函数

    如何优化使用Oracle的sign函数

    Oracle的SIGN函数用于返回一个数字的符号 使用索引:确保在涉及到的列上创建适当的索引,以加快查询速度。 避免使用SELECT *:尽量只查询需要的列,而不是使用SE...

  • Oracle的sign函数与其他数据库有何不同

    Oracle的sign函数与其他数据库有何不同

    Oracle的SIGN函数用于返回一个数字的符号
    以下是Oracle SIGN函数的语法:
    SIGN(number) 这里,number是要计算其符号的数值。如果number为正数,则SIGN...

  • 何时应该考虑对Oracle表进行重建

    何时应该考虑对Oracle表进行重建

    在Oracle数据库中,表的重建是一个重要的维护操作,它可以帮助优化表和索引的性能。以下是考虑重建Oracle表的一些关键条件和情况:
    何时考虑对Oracle表进行...

  • Oracle重建索引的步骤是什么

    Oracle重建索引的步骤是什么

    Oracle重建索引的步骤主要包括确定需要重建的索引、分析索引状态、执行重建操作,并在必要时考虑在线重建以减少对数据库性能的影响。以下是具体的步骤和注意事项...

  • sign函数在Oracle的最新版本中有何更新

    sign函数在Oracle的最新版本中有何更新

    Oracle数据库的SIGN函数用于返回一个数字的符号
    在Oracle 12c及更高版本中,SIGN函数的语法和功能保持不变。以下是SIGN函数的基本语法:
    SIGN(n) 其中...

  • 如何测试Oracle的sign函数准确性

    如何测试Oracle的sign函数准确性

    要测试Oracle的SIGN函数的准确性,您可以创建一个简单的测试用例来验证其行为是否符合预期 登录到Oracle数据库。
    打开SQL*Plus或任何其他支持Oracle SQL的工...